    Abstract: An electric hammer includes a housing, an electric motor, an output assembly, an impact assembly, a mounting shaft, a clutch assembly, and a switching assembly. The mounting shaft is rotatable about a second axis. When the electric hammer is in the drill mode, a sleeve of the output assembly rotates. When the electric hammer is in the hammer drill mode, the sleeve rotates and an impact block of the impact assembly reciprocates in the sleeve. The switching assembly is configured to switch the clutch assembly between a first state and a second state and includes a switching element. The switching element includes a forced end and a drive end, the output assembly moving along a first axis drives the forced end to move, and the drive end is configured to drive the clutch assembly to be switched to the first state.

    Abstract: A method and a system for diagnosing high-enthalpy shock tunnel flow field parameters are provided. In the method, the parameters of the reservoir at the end of shock tunnel and nozzle free flow are measured by using a contact measurement technology and a non-contact spectrum measurement technology to diagnose the high-enthalpy shock tunnel flow field. With the method, not only flow field temperature, pressure, component category and component concentration, but also non-equilibrium state information of the flow field and the effective wind tunnel working time can be obtained.

    Abstract: A wake up signal scheme between a network and a user equipment (UE) operating in a Discontinuous Reception (DRX) state. The UE monitors a wake up signal (WUS) occasion to determine whether a WUS is received during the WUS occasion, when the WUS is received, determines whether the WUS identifies the UE, when the WUS is received and identifies the UE, monitors an OnDuration of a Discontinuous Reception (DRX) cycle corresponding to the WUS and when the WUS is not received or the WUS does not identify the UE, remains in a sleep state during the OnDuration corresponding to the WUS.

    Abstract: A ribbon type high frequency loudspeaker structure has a ring-shaped upper magnetic plate, a ring-shaped magnet, and a lower T-shaped magnetic plate with an inner magnet pole, which form a magnetic path structure. The inner magnet pole of the lower T-shaped magnetic plate is located in the center of the ring of the ring-shaped upper magnetic plate and the ring-shaped magnet. An inter-magnet gap is formed between the outer pole surface of the inner magnet pole and the inner ring surface of the ring-shaped magnet. A flat-type vibration diaphragm is set on the top of the upper magnetic plate said fiat-type vibration diaphragm is formed by molding a spiral-shaped flat coil on the substrate surface of the non-conductive thin film. The flat-type coil is located in the inter-magnet gap between the upper magnetic plate and the lower T-shaped magnetic plate.
